Output d0f389249aa15a3308248013989d81b89216b3f5a812584ddaf41442acd75238:16

value
995494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2b428ca67377e766b20a26a86dbbacb2c1ae27 OP_EQUAL
address
3MmAQW1qyNLrQ1C6JwGJMoZwsvsB3baNrQ
transaction
d0f389249aa15a3308248013989d81b89216b3f5a812584ddaf41442acd75238
spent
true